The 97th Academy Awards, also known as the 2025 Oscars, took place on a very special night that celebrated the biggest movies from 2024 and the incredible people who brought them to the big screen.
Think back to the decade of neon windbreakers, Saturday morning cartoons, and lunchboxes that made you the coolest kid at the ...
'Ella McCay' is a huge mess. Can we pretend it never happened?